Your New Role and Responsibilities

Are you ready to earn while you learn want to gain a nationally recognised qualification and join a team thats invested in your future

If youre technically minded enjoy problem solving love working with your hands and want a career that keeps you learning this could be the opportunity for you. No experience No problem well teach you.

Leidos Australia have two full-time Aircraft Maintenance Engineer (AME) apprenticeships (B1 & B2) based in either Cairns or Darwin. This structured hands-on training program spans four years and leads to a nationally recognised qualification as an Aircraft Maintenance Engineer (AME). In this role you will;

  • Inspect troubleshoot maintain and repair electronic and / or mechanical aspect of an aircraft.

  • Hold safety as a core value and contribute to the achievement of a zero harm and incident/injury free environment.

  • Carry out maintenance tasks in accordance with the Maintenance manuals and specified procedures.

  • Be responsible for personal tool control accountability of tools and equipment and upkeep of the hanger workshop and any related work vehicles.

What Youll Bring to Make An Impact

  • Strong mechanical or electrical understanding and skills.

  • Ability and motivation to attend and pass required training to obtain a Certificate IV in Aeroskills.

  • Completed minimum of Year 10 or equivalent.

  • High level of attention to detail.

  • Be eligible to hold an ASIC card.
